The efficacy and function of daylily

Clears heat and promotes diuresis, cools blood and stops bleeding. Used for mumps, jaundice, cystitis, hematuria, dysuria, lack of milk, irregular menstruation, epistaxis, and bloody stool. Used externally to treat mastitis.

It is mainly used to treat sand stranguria and water retention. People with yellow jaundice all over their body can drink the juice of the root. If nose bleeding is caused by high fever, grind a large cup of juice, add half a cup of ginger juice, and swallow it slowly. Crush the root and take it with wine, and apply the residue on the breasts to promote lactation and treat breast abscess and swelling.

Dosage and Usage of Hemerocallis

10-20 grams, apply externally in appropriate amount and mash it and apply to the affected area.

Selection of daylily

Treats hematuria, leucorrhea, and painful urination

Take 30g each of daylily, cat's hair grass and raw imperata root and 15g of mountain twig fruit, decocted in water and taken orally.

Treating hemorrhage in women

Add 120 grams of fresh daylily root to three bowls of water and boil it into one bowl. Remove the residue and add three eggs (fried) and boil together.

Treat blood in stool

90-120 grams of fresh daylily root and 120 grams of pork red meat, decocted in water and taken orally.

Treats red and painful urination

Take 15 grams each of daylily, herbaceous clover, and camellia sinensis, decocted in water and taken orally.

Treat mumps

Stew 60 grams of daylily root with appropriate amount of rock sugar, and use fresh roots to mash and apply externally.

To treat overwork, injuries, chest and flank pain: decocted 15-30 grams of dried daylily flowers in water.

Treat rheumatoid arthritis

30-60 grams of fresh daylily root, 1 pig's foot, add 1 jin of rice wine, or half water and half rice wine, stew for about 2 hours, and take before meals.

To treat toothache caused by stomach fire: decocted 30-60 grams of fresh daylily in water.
